flag Irish childcare center ordered to pay €3,000 for rejecting nut-allergic toddler, ruled discriminatory.

flag A childcare center in Ireland was ordered to pay €3,000 in compensation for rejecting a two-year-old girl with a severe nut allergy, deemed a form of disability discrimination. flag The Workplace Relations Commission ruled against the center under the Equal Status Act 2000, stating it failed to accommodate the child's condition. flag The center had previously been aware of her allergy and had made arrangements, but later refused to accept her EpiPens and insisted the parents remove her.
